A Norfolk County resident is facing multiple charges following a break-and-enter investigation last Friday.
Norfolk County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) responded to a 9-1-1 call reporting a suspected break-and-enter at a home on Norfolk Street North in Simcoe.
Officers arrived on scene and conducted a search of the property, where they located an individual inside the residence.
The investigation confirmed that damage had been caused to the interior of the home, though no one else was present at the time.
The individual, identified as a 53-year-old Norfolk County man, was taken into custody without incident.
He has been charged with unlawfully being in a dwelling house, mischief causing damage to property, and failing to comply with a probation order.
